Range Riders Recap: Kirtley's Heroics, Dinesen's Departure, and Voyagers Showdown

Host Josh Amick recaps the Glacier Range Riders' challenging series against the Missoula PaddleHeads, highlighting Christian Kirtley's record-breaking performance with six home runs. Despite initial losses, the Range Riders managed a comeback with key home runs from Gabe Howell and Ty Penner, showcasing resilience after losing their longest-tenured player, Mason Dinesen, to the Chicago White Sox. Looking forward, they prepare for a critical series against the Great Falls Voyagers to maintain their playoff position in the Pioneer League.

Tuesday the range Riders headed to Missoula to face the top rank Missoula paddleheads for a big six game series as the they trailed them by four games for the top seed in the Pioneer league in game one of the series the paddle heads won 16 to 10 despite a record-breaking performance by Christian kurtley ctle Homer not once not twice but three times to set the record for the most home runs in a game by a range Riders player he also drove in all 10 runs for the range Riders and finished the day with 14 total bases both of those were records as well unfortunately his performance wasn't enough as Missoula connected on four home runs and 17 hits for game one Victory Wednesday the range Riders pitchers held the top ranked Missoula offense to five runs but the paddle head still homward three times and a 5 to3 win the range riders only had four hits all game two of them being home runs by Ben Fitzgerald and Gabe how it was how's first home run of the Season as he rejoined the team last week he was with the range Riders last year and he led the team an on base percentage before joining the team this year Year from the Atlantic league and game three was another lowc scoring Affair as the paddleheads won again 6 to3 Andy Atwood the usual leadoff hitter for the range Riders was moved into the seventh spot and it seemed like the move paid off Atwood went two for four and connected on a home run after being held to 1 and N in his previous at bats of the series kurtley connected on a solo shot in the eighth his fourth home run of the series and tacked on to his team leading 11 home runs on the season Friday the range Riders lost in heartbreaking fashion they held the 6-3 lead heading into the bottom of the eighth before the paddleheads rally for three runs to not things up at 6 to6 Cameron Cowan came in for relief for the range Riders and loaded the bases with zero outs he would retire the next batter before Colin run stepped up to the plate and hit a game-winning base hit and the range Riders lost seven to six their fourth straight loss in game five of the series The Range Riders bats erupted for five home runs in a 14- 12 Victory to snap the four game skid Gabe Hal hit his second home run of the season and Tai pener who was activated off the iil last week connected on a home run is third of the Year Andy Atwood and Freddy Geo also homered for the range Riders and Christian Curley continued his Onslaught against the Missoula paddleheads pitching staff with two more home runs the range Riders Bullpen also did a great job combining for four scoreless Innings to maintain their lead and win the first first game of the series The Range Riders Bullpen also did a great job combining for four scoreless Innings to maintain their lead and win the first game of their series Sunday was my game of the week as the range Riders won again 14 to 12 the range Riders jumped out to an early 10 to4 lead after three Innings capped off by Gabe how's three-run home run and Tai Penner solo shot Nick Block also connected on a solo home run to extend the lead to 11 to4 and the range Riders were able to Stile The Comeback attempt and hold line to Victory that's it for the scoring recap of the week after the range Riders dropped the first four games they were able to bounce back and win the next two to end the road trip on a high note well sort of Sunday's game wasn't my game of the week because of the score the barrage of hits from the range Riders it was the team's resiliency that made it my game of the week after dropping the first three games they lost the fourth game on a walk-off and appeared like the paddleheads were just too much for the range Riders they answered back with a big win Saturday and Sunday's Victory shows the team's ability to adapt to changes which leads me to this week's portion of in case you missed it after Saturday's Victory it was announced by the range Rider social media team that Mason Dennison's contract had been purchased by Chicago White Socks which marked the end of his time with the team they went into Sunday's game without their team leader in average and stolen bases but the stats don't tell the whole St story Dennison was also the longest tenured player on the Range Riders who has been with the team since their inaugural season he is unquestionably a huge loss for the team the fan base and the way the team was able to Rally around him and win the game on Sunday without him there was huge here are some thoughts from manager Paul Fletcher who spoke about Mason Dennison earlier this season well you know Mason's kind of a versatile guy he kind of moved around right sometimes he was hitting at the top sometimes the bottom in between and and we've kind of done that to him a little bit here this year just to try and see where we need him the most and he's he's very adapt to it he doesn't get bothered by it he just goes out and plays hard every day he's he's one of those guys that really has a lot of skill set that that I think transfers to the next level um but for here he's he's just a wonderful guy do whatever you need him to do great team player Dennison was also a player who played all over the field and all throughout the lineup Gabe how will be most likely called upon to fill that void as the everyday short stop a role he is familiar with as I mentioned before he was with the team last season in that role Tai Penner will also be expected to fill that void in the infield as Ben fitzg will most likely be called upon to play more time and left as they want to keep a good balanced lineup it will be a team effort to replace the role Dennison has played over the last three seasons also in case you miss it Christian kirtley had a huge week against the pads hting six home runs and Joven 16 and he's now the team leader in home runs in RBIs on the season I would not be surprised at all if he is named the PB player of the week looking ahead the range drivers open a six-game series with an all too familiar opponent the Great Falls voyagers this will be the fourth series these two teams have sored off against each other and the rain drivers are hoping for similar results they had in the previous series two weeks ago the range Riders lost the first game of the series against Great Falls before rattling off five straight wins the range Riders pitching was dominant over that winning streak and will be needed again if they hope to maintain their spot in the second seed there are 12 games left of the first half of the season with the top two seeds guaranteed a playoff spot the team trailing the range Riders currently is the Boise Hawks who the range Riders face in the final six games of the first half of the Season it could be a big series to determine which of those
